Transaction 1bf750d6982796ff27132f7bdb03b12ca5390eb86f9014226b9eca0efdaf76f6
1 Input
1 Output
-
1bf750d6982796ff27132f7bdb03b12ca5390eb86f9014226b9eca0efdaf76f6:0
- value
- 555091
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b88625c64d1da39c09069be4baa1acbb2a9fc61 OP_EQUAL
- address
- 3A2zo9CfpMzorxrErBmzxePTz7y1xeW5Wh